"Virat Kohli is Cristiano Ronaldo of cricket," says Dwayne Bravo

Bravo is currently playing IPL for Chennai Super Kings.

Virat Kohli and Dwayne Bravo | GETTY

Chennai Super Kings (CSK) all-rounder Dwayne Bravo has compared the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) skipper with football legend Cristiano Ronaldo. Both the players are considered as greats of their respective games.

Bravo, praising Virat, said he tells his younger brother Darren Bravo to follow the footmark of Indian stalwart. His brother and Virat both have played Under-19 cricket together. 

"It's (equation with Virat is) good. Virat actually played under-19 (cricket) with my younger brother Darren and I always tell my brother that Virat is a person he shall look up to, I am not saying that because I am here," 34-year-old said.

"I actually asked Virat to talk to my brother personally about batting, about cricket. When I see Virat, I see Cristiano Ronaldo of cricket.

"For me as a cricket player to play against him and to watch him play when he represents India, even RCB, I admire the talent that he has, the passion he has for the game, for the sport when he plays. So hats off to him and he deserves all the achievement," he added.

The Caribbean cricketer was present at the launch of the New Era's signature headwear collection designed and conceptualized by Kohli himself. The Indian cricket team skipper was present there too.

Kohli revealed he had visited the New Era office during Champions Trophy. "I was very involved (in the cap designing process). I took out time when we were playing the Champions Trophy in England to go to the office (of New Era) and meet with the team and I spent about three hours there going through all the materials of caps and designs," Kohli remarked.
